My Buying Guides on Elastic For Bracelets
When I first started making bracelets, choosing the right elastic was one of the most important steps. Over time, I’ve learned what works best for different styles and needs. Here’s my guide to help you pick the perfect elastic for your bracelet projects.
1. Understand the Types of Elastic
There are several types of elastic cords available, and knowing their differences can make a big difference in your bracelet’s look and durability. The most common types I use are:
- Stretch Magic (Clear Elastic Cord): This is my go-to for invisible, stretchy bracelets. It’s smooth and holds knots well.
- Braided Elastic Cord: Thicker and stronger, this is great for heavier beads or larger bracelets.
- Elastic String: Usually thinner and less durable, I avoid this for anything but very light beads.
2. Consider the Thickness
Elastic cords come in different thicknesses, typically measured in millimeters. I’ve found that:
- For delicate bracelets with small beads, a 0.5mm to 0.8mm elastic works great.
- For heavier beads or chunkier styles, 1mm to 1.5mm thickness offers better strength without sacrificing stretch.
Choosing the right thickness prevents breakage and ensures comfort.
3. Check Elastic Strength and Quality
Not all elastics are created equal. I always look for brands known for durability. A good elastic should stretch easily but snap back to its original length without sagging. Also, the elastic should be resistant to fraying and discoloration over time—especially if you plan to wear your bracelet daily.
4. Transparency and Color Options
Sometimes, I want my elastic to be invisible, so clear elastic is perfect. Other times, I choose colored elastic cords to complement or contrast with my beads. Some elastics come in vibrant colors or even metallic sheens, which can add a unique touch to your bracelet designs.
5. Knotting and Finishing Tips
A strong knot is essential to keep the elastic secure. I usually double or triple knot the elastic and add a drop of jewelry glue to lock it in place. Some elastics hold knots better than others, so test a small piece before starting your full project.
6. Length and Quantity to Buy
Before buying, I measure my wrist plus a little extra for knots to determine the needed length. It’s smart to buy elastic in longer lengths or packs to avoid running out mid-project. Some sellers offer pre-cut lengths, which are convenient for beginners.
7. Budget Considerations
While I want quality, I also keep an eye on price. Usually, buying elastic in bulk or multipacks offers better value. However, I avoid the cheapest elastics because they tend to break easily and cause frustration.
